Latvia - Sugar Crops Direct Material Inputs
Since 2014, Latvia Sugar Crops Direct Material Inputs was up 4.7% year on year. At 0.05 Metric Tons Per Capita in 2019, the country was number 23 among other countries in Sugar Crops Direct Material Inputs. Latvia is overtaken by Italy, which was number 22 with 0.06 Metric Tons Per Capita and is followed by Malta at 0.05 Metric Tons Per Capita. France lead the ranking with 0.67 Metric Tons Per Capita in 2019, that is an increase of 4.2% compared to 2018. Belgium, Denmark and Netherlands resp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Bulgaria witnessed the best average annual growth at +9.4% per year, while Greece was the worst growing country at -14.1% per year.
